The street in brief

Quarry Lane is mostly detached houses. The median sale price is £246,000, about 32% below the typical BN25 sale. On floor area that works out near £4,202 per square metre, in line with the district's £4,070. Recent sales have moved in step with the wider district. With 79 sales across 50 homes since 2001, homes here come to market only rarely.

Sales marked non-standardare Land Registry “additional price paid” entries — bulk purchases, repossessions, right-to-buy and similar transfers. They're listed for completeness but excluded from every median and comparison figure on this page.
